Horsham offers a wide range of shops and other amenities, including a sports centre, theatre and arts centre. Outstanding ofsted secondary schools and great primary schools are available.

Horsham is a highly desirable market town, rated in the top ten most sought-after market towns in England (Daily Telegraph, March 2015). The picturesque High Street has an unrivalled row of historic buildings giving the town a wealth of character.

Rail services to London Victoria and London Bridge depart from Horsham regularly making it a perfect commuter town. The M23, M25 and Gatwick Airport are also within a short driving distance.
